Tata Sky Binge+ could be Airtel Xsteam Box rival coming soon

The details of the device remain scant at this moment but third party sources suggest it will launch this year. It will support digital video broadcast (DVB-S2) as well as IPTV for content delivery.

Binge+ from Tata Sky will be powered by a Broadcom CPU. The dual-core processor will have a clock frequency of 1.8GHz and use Broadcom VideoCore V HW for graphics. It will have 2GB of RAM and 8GB internal storage. There is also mention of the device being built by Technicolor and has received Indian CRS and Bluetooth certifications. It will have Accedo user interface or launcher but don’t count on Pie at the time of launch.

Launched for Rs 5999. (No mention of upgrade price for existing customers)

kbxn4da.webp


Google Android OS
Chromecast Included
1 month free trial to Tata Sky Binge Service (Hotstar, ZEE5, Sun NXT, Eros Now, Hungama, 7 Day Rewatch TV) and then Rs 249/month
2GB RAM and 8GB internal storage
